Subject: Partner SFTP drop — new owner

Hi,

As you review the pending changes to the Harborline ingest scripts, note that ownership of the partner SFTP drop is changing at the end of the month. This includes key rotation, the nightly pull job, and the quarantine folder for malformed files. Review comments on the retry logic should still go through the normal PR flow, but questions about drop-folder conventions or partner onboarding now go to the new owner. The incoming owner is listed below.

signatory, tagaf-bahaf: Praael Fenmir Rusok

Postmortem action item — DupeSquash deduplicator

During the Wexhall incident, DupeSquash collapsed two genuinely distinct alerts because the fingerprint ignored the region field. Action: add region to the dedup key and backfill tests covering cross-region storms. Reviewers, please be picky here — a bad fingerprint change either floods on-call or silently drops pages. Draft PR is up; the design notes and test matrix are on the internal page below:

runbook for tafof-yawif: https://confluence.tolvaqsys.internal/display/display/browse/pages/7be3

### v4.2.0 — Customer record deduplication

Merged duplicate customer records in Harborline using fuzzy matching on normalized names plus billing history overlap. Roughly 12k pairs collapsed; merge decisions are logged for rollback. Reviewers: check the threshold constants and the tie-breaking logic before approving. Questions during review go to the change author named below.

approver of faduf-bagug = Framir Sorwyn

Capacity note: the nightly inventory reconciliation job for Marrowline Goods now scans roughly 40% more SKUs since the Tellhaven warehouse onboarding. Expect the batch window to run closer to its ceiling; if it slips past 03:30, page the data platform rotation rather than restarting mid-run, since a restart re-locks the ledger partitions. Memory headroom is fine, but shard fan-out and retry backoff need to match the new volume. The constants below were validated against last week's load replay.

constants for tageg-kagag:
QUOTAS = {
    "kelax": 495,
    "istath": 366,
    "tammir": 108,
    "novdor": 730,
    "casax": 816,
    "quenael": 874,
    "pelius": 403,
}